## Alert: StatRelay Sidecar Flush Lag

This alert fires when the StatRelay metrics-aggregation sidecar falls more than 120 seconds behind on flushing buffered samples to the Coalmine backend. Plugin-emitted counters are buffered in-process, so sustained lag usually means a plugin is emitting unbounded label cardinality or blocking the flush thread. Check your plugin's metric registration against the published cardinality limits before escalating. If the lag persists after your plugin is ruled out, contact the telemetry team.

escalation mailbox, bagug-fahof: novdor.wendor.jormir@norvalabs.example

### Step 4: Enable the waveform preview service

After migrating Soundplinth assets to the new bucket layout, restart the preview renderer so it picks up the relocated peak files. Renders will fail silently if the cache path still points at the legacy mount. Before restarting, ensure the renderer is configured with the following values.

config for kafof-bawef:
holath:
  log_level: debug
  metrics_host: metrics.holath.qorvelsys.internal
  pin: 2191
  pool_size: 32

Subject: Support outsourcing — quick primer

Hi all, and welcome to Renata ahead of her start date. Short version: tier-one support for Glimwick moves to Parstow Outsourcing in the autumn. Trial metrics look good, costs down about a fifth. Renata will own the transition plan from day one. Happy to walk anyone through it. One item stays within this thread.

internal memo for kaduf-baduf: Only 35 of the 378 pilot accounts renewed Holir, so a churn review is set for June 11. Eliielax Group is in early talks to buy Silaelix Group for about $142.1 million.